The current President of the United States is Joe Biden. He was inaugurated on January 20, 2021, after winning the presidential election in November 2020. Biden, a member of the Democratic Party, previously served as Vice President under Barack Obama from 2009 to 2017. His presidency has focused on various issues, including economic recovery, healthcare, and climate change.

The other individuals listed are former presidents. Donald Trump served as the 45th president from January 2017 to January 2021. Barack Obama was the 44th president from January 2009 to January 2017, while George W. Bush served as the 43rd president from January 2001 to January 2009. Their terms have ended, which distinguishes Joe Biden as the current leader of the executive branch of the U.S. government.
